La Comunidad–To limpia or not to limpia? March 20, 2020 – Posted in: Blog, recent

We are entering Spring Equinox.  The world is on alert and populations are challenged as never before. As a Chicana/mexicana-indigena I grew up and have always had limpias as part of our lives.  We do all kinds of limpias–sweeping with a huevo, usamos hierbas y aquas preparadas, baños.
